Miss Payn 11 October 2019 Looked everywhere for one small enough to fit my washbasin - plughole has 6cm external diameter (incl surround) and 3.5cm internal diameter. The small Lakeland one fits perfectly. It is much easier to find the larger ones to fit *baths*, but it is useful to have a spare. The large Lakeland one fits my bath plughole, which is 7cm/4.5cm. The strainers are hard at work trapping hairs and soap-slime which would have clogged the waste-trap. Glad to say that they really are of stainless steel, in contrast to some dull metal ones from a rival seller which I had to return as they rusted in days!

2 Sink & Plughole Strainers 1 "Disapointingly small" Lesley 30 April 2012 It would have been helpful if the size of these sink strainers were included on the web page. Even the large one is too small for my sink. Will be giving them to someone who can use them A note from the team Thanks for placing your review. The web team are putting the dimensions on the item page. The small strainer is 6 cms external width (3.2cms inner) and the large is 7.5cms external (inner 3.5cms).
